I've had luck by not feeding the fish for a day or two, then putting the net in the tank for about an hour (so the fish gets used to it), then putting food at the top right under the net. Fish is hungry so swims up and swoosh! right into the net he goes!

If you are talking about the Arc Eye Hawkfish which I am assuming you are. The are a very aggressive fish, which grows to 6", and is NOT reef compatable. Definaelty not a fish for a Nano Reef. You best bet would be to catch it, and return it.
